Abstract

In an infinite-dimensional Hilbert space, the normal Mann’s iteration has only weak convergence, in general, even for nonexpansive mappings. The purpose of this paper is to modify the normal Mann’s iteration to have strong convergence for a family of Lipschitz quasi-pseudocontractions in the framework of Hilbert spaces. Our results improve and extend the corresponding ones announced by many others.
